Hello all
I am finally the proud owner of a ZX80. It works but the output on my telly (even an old CRT) is predictably poor.
Are there any non-invasive methods of improving the output? Its is such nice condition I don’t want to open the case.
By way of example there is the Chroma 81 for the ZX81 - is there anything similar for the ‘80?

Re: ZX80 video improvements
ZX8-CCB can be used
I upgraded the ZX80 that Richard owned. I put the ZX8-CCB in the modulator can as that was what was requested. But you don’t have to do that.
Chroma 80 interface (coming soon) according to Paul’s web site...

Re: ZX80 video improvements
I had great success with the 555 based back porch generator from:
http://zx.zigg.net/misc-projects/
It works very well. Granted it is a bit more complicated, but if you add an external power source you won't have to open your ZX80 up at all. Here it is working on my ZX80:
